Transaction d883f88248819fd5e645d71791c7c8c3cc710502c65a65ed9e8e5e9eb5de3d38

5 Input
1 Outputs
  • d883f88248819fd5e645d71791c7c8c3cc710502c65a65ed9e8e5e9eb5de3d38:0
  • value  21072407
    address  16CoEWVVaiXCyJnLgMcmTu9nKMsx2BCmzp